Job Summary:
Participates in the quality care of our patients by providing medical dosimetry services meeting or exceeding any national standards of care in radiation oncology. Actively participates in outstanding customer service and accepts responsibility in maintaining relationships that are equally respectful to all.
You Will Be Responsible For:
Demonstrates, through behavior, AdventHealths core values of Integrity, Compassion, Balance, Excellence, Stewardship, and Teamwork.
- Discusses patient diagnosis with physicians.
- Assist in simulation process, including collection of pertinent data required for treatment planning.
- Accurately transpose patient data into treatment planning system.
- Accurately and proficiently performs dosimetric calculations for external beam treatment plans.
- Accurately and proficiently performs dosimetric calculations for IMRT treatment plans.
- Accurately and proficiently performs dosimetric calculations for brachytherapy plans.
Qualifications
What You Will Need:
Required:
- Minimum of B.S. or B.A. degree in Physics or related field, OR Radiation Therapy Technology certification (no expiration)
- Certified Medical Dosimetrist (CMD)
- Strong knowledge of medical dosimetry
- Effective communication skills
Preferred:
- Five years of clinical medical dosimetry experience
